As a former E39 M5 owner in the UK some thoughts to consider: 1) What state is the double vanos in? The system also adds a lovely rattle on start up hot or cold when it's tired. The Vanos can be rebuilt and for sensible money 2) Timing chain and guides can be done in situ if you remove the cooling pack. 3) If you are taking the engine out seriously consider a full bottom end refresh as worn bearings can accelerate bore wear, and if the bores glaze, that's the end of the block because being all alloy with nikasil bore coating there are no machining options and there are no new S62 blocks out there. Also get new engine mounts, they're dynamic and often have long given up being dynamic by now. 4) Front bumper shell is the same as the stock sport models, only the lower grille is different. (I had an '02 E39 530d Sport Touring before the M5). A good used front sport bumper shouldn't be mad money! 5) Unless those after market dampers are high end seriously considering getting the oe spec alloy bodied, they are seriously good bits of kit. 6) While the rear diff is out for a seal refresh check the state of the bearings and the clutch plates in it. Mine were shagged. The gearbox output seal needed doing too as when the prop came out so did all the gearbox oil with it! 8) Check the wiring loom where it goes through the hinges into the trunk lid. The PVC sheaths on the wires go brittle, crack and then the copper wires inside work harden and snap leading to all sorts of fun and games...and small fires too... 9) For your amusement I still have a genuine E39 M5 rear diffuser...one with a removable centre section for the genuine BMW M5 Westfalia removable swan neck tow bar that I also still happen to have! Unfortunately, like me, they're in the UK... I still miss my M5 today, 5 years after selling it, it was an event each time I went out for a drive. But what I don't miss is the daft 'M' tax for parts that weren't exactly unique to the car...

Genuine bumper bars are available for years after the vehicle has been first sold. Sourcing replacements for crash repairs is simple, fits first time. Aftermarket bumper bars don't fit first time, if at all, and sourcing replacements can be difficult for crash repairs if the brand/supplier is unknown, and still in business. I'd go for the genuine part, but I'm biased because I used to work as a BMW Parts Interpreter. I've sen so many BMW's with dodgy bumper bars, and so many crash repairers complaining that the original bumper bar I supplied is different to the one on the car. Not only that, but all the periphery parts may not fit , such as fog lights, grilles, splitters, brackets, headlamps etc. Also, BMW brake discs and pads are relatively soft to give a better feel for the driver. You'll probably need to replace the discs and pads and wear sensors. People often use aftermarket pads, which are harder, and wear the discs out, so it's actually not saving them money.

Timing chain rattle? I don’t think so, on the early 2000 M5 it’s the old design vanos spring plates and the old design vanos accumulator not holding the pressure when the engine is off. It’s a well know issue, albeit it doesn’t harm the motor, just sounds like a diesel on start and idle.
@pete540Z
@pete540Z 3 жыл бұрын
Agreed. I had a 2000 M5 and put the upgraded later accumulator on it and the rattle at startup went away. I had a 2002 M5 with 254K miles when I got rid of it. Not timing chain rattle (I know what that sounds like). The correct maintenance with the good oil can make those plastic lined guides last a long time. That car ran and drove great, rust killed it, the jacking points crushed into the body. Now in an 85K mile 2001, just did rod bearings, lower main bearings, clutch, cam pos and MAF sensors, brakes, used and good DINAN springs and struts/shocks, and SuperSprint mufflers. I picked it up cheap (10K). Now it's my daily driver. I love these cars!
